“We have the two group campground sites and they were wonderful for the 18 in our group. It is tent only. Wilderness only miles from the city. Flush toilets cleaned every day. There is a pavilion for the campers but picnic areas are in other areas of the park.”

“Absolutely gorgeous campground. Stayed in one of the Sherman cabins. It was clean and well maintained. The fridge, microwave, ceiling fan and heater worked great. There was also a small supply of paper towels and trash bags. The camp host was friendly and helpful. The campground itself was quite peaceful. Very relaxing. There is a strip mine reclamation happening, lots of new trees planted. Looking forward to seeing it in a few years when the trees have grown. The North Country Scenic trail runs through the campground as well as a few other trails. I would like to have explored them all. Will definitely be back.”
